Build 37.1

Updates and Improvements:

  1. PHS question OT-2 (Other Topics) was modified from “OT-2: Are you now, or have you ever been, a member or associate of a criminal enterprise, street gang, or any group that advocates violence against individuals because of their race, religion, political affiliation, ethnic affiliation, ethnic origin, nationality, gender, gender identity, sexual preference, or disability?” to: OT-2: Are you now, or have you ever been, a member or associate of a criminal enterprise, street gang, or any group, to include Internet sourced that advocates violence and/or hatred against individuals because of their race, religion, political affiliation, ethnic affiliation, ethnic origin, nationality, gender, gender identity, sexual preference, or disability?”

  2. Made it simpler for other law enforcement agencies to print their questionnaire when completing a questionnaire for another POBITS account.

  3. Made modest adjustments to the layout in the prior employment section of the printed PHS for employment history.

  4. Created a process that sends an email to each investigator that lists their open cases, their open reviews, and their open tasks. For now, I will fire this task off and request feedback before making it a nightly job on the server.

  5. When a manager views the account’s investigators from the Account Settings menu, you can now expand each row to reveal the investigator’s Open Cases, Open Reviews, and Open Tasks.

  6. Modified Preloaded Tasks so that a task that is set to AutoInitiate is initiated by “System’ vs. the logged-in investigator.
